“…Even “precise” weapons can land at precisely wrong locations and cause incidents of unintended suffering. Shaw (1997) compiled several different causes for such tragic outcomes: system inadequacies, human error, incomplete intelligence, enemy defenses, environmental conditions, and inadequate comprehension. Such a wide range of possible causes and the roles of circumstance and error seem to defy attempts at their elimination.…”
